How can technology improve platform due diligence?

clock

Clive Waller, managing director of CWC Research, looks at technology developments affecting the platform industry.

The wrap community, which is pretty much all of us, anxiously awaits the next consultation paper, following DP 10/2. It was set for the summer but has been delayed, we assume, due to the huge lobbying effort from the fund platforms. This delay is not good for an industry that needs to invest heavily in technology. Indeed, recently rumoured uncertainly about the very future of RDR itself does little for the reputation of the regulator.
